Getting ahead of your financial investment rivals is a huge benefit of having a realty license. As a licensed North Carolina realty broker, you can get to the Several Listing Service (MLS), supplying you with two advantages. Initially, you can concentrate on the very best areas and spot new homes on the marketplace faster than relying on a property broker to find them and communicate the information to you. Second, there is valuable historic data on every residential or commercial property and area that you can mine. The MLS will provide you info about past and present prices, comps with comparable residential or commercial properties for contrasts, and other valuable info.
With MLS information, you can see which neighborhoods offer faster, the types of houses that are most popular with purchasers, and the sort of buyers to pursue. Think of it. You make a commission when you buy residential or commercial properties. Let's say you buy a $200,000 house where the overall commission is 6%. That suggests the selling broker's office gets $6,000 and your office gets the other $6,000. If you have a 50/50 commission split with your workplace, you get a $3,000 commission. When you offer your house for $300,000 as the listing representative, you will wind up swiping a $4,500 commission after all the splits between offices and your broker-in-charge. Even better, you sell your house without another broker being involved, earning you a $9,000 commission. Taking control of your offers is another advantage.
